An Improved Health Monitoring System using IOT

Abstract
Improvement in the quality and efficiency of health and medicine, at home and in hospital, has become paramount importance. Humans are facing the problem of unexpected death due to various illnesses which is due to a lack of medical care for the patients at right time. The solution to this problem would require the continuous monitoring of several key patient parameters, including body temperature, heart rate and oxygen saturation in the blood. The primary requirement is to develop a reliable patient monitoring system so that healthcare professionals can monitor their patients, who are either hospitalized or at home. IoT based integrated healthcare system ensures that the patients’ health parameter monitoring can be taken care in a better way. Recent advances in embedded systems, microelectronics, sensors and wireless networking enable the design of wearable systems capable of such health monitoring. In this paper, an improved health monitoring system is proposed which affords the monitoring of skin temperature and heart activity. A compact wrist device is designed based on a programmable microprocessor unit capable of sending data using IoT. Two different systems are designed using Raspberry Pi and NODEMCU and compared by testing the developed hardware with a user interface for checking reliability.
